Nitrogen oxides (NOₓ) are a group of pollutants formed from nitrogen and oxygen, primarily referring to nitric oxide (NO) and nitrogen dioxide (NO₂). These gases have adverse health effects and contribute to smog, acid rain, and ozone formation.
Carbon Monoxide, formed by the incomplete burning of carbon-based fuels, is invisible, odorless, and poisonous. It contributes indirectly to climate change and is regulated globally.
